**Runbook: Audit-log viewer — Ferrowatch**

If folks report the Ferrowatch audit-log viewer showing stale entries, it's almost always the indexer lagging, not data loss. Check the indexer lag metric first — under 5 minutes is fine, just wait it out. Over 15 minutes, restart the indexer pod on the Duskvale cluster; it catches up fast. Don't touch the retention job while the indexer is behind, that's how we got the gap last quarter. Step-by-step restart instructions and the escalation rota are on the page below.

runbook for yafof-kahif: https://jira.qorvelsys.internal/browse/display/pages/browse/0c52

**Runbook: Locker access flow (TumbleHub)**

When a resident reports a stuck laundry locker, first confirm their pickup code was issued within the last 24 hours. Stale codes are rejected by the latch firmware. Re-issue from the Dispatch console and ask them to retry. If the latch still refuses, the firmware revision matters — check it against this reference build.

session token of tajef-bageg = htk21_5d90d574934f3ccae6437

## Tuning

Order-cutoff behavior for the Copperwhisk bakery app lives in one config module. Cutoff time, grace window, and rollover day are all adjustable; everything else derives from them. Change values only in config, never inline. Test with the simulated-clock suite before shipping, and note any change in the changelog since storefront staff in Dunmallow rely on the posted cutoff. The current constants are shown below.

constants for hahip-hafog:
WEIGHTS = {
    "feniel": 55,
    "kasox": 667,
}

Plugin builds fail on the Sweepline CI if your retention rules declare overlapping windows — the validator rejects them before tests run. Fix the manifest, don't patch the validator. Sandbox runs get a scratch dataset; anything your plugin deletes there is gone, no restore. If your plugin passes locally but fails in CI, you're probably depending on the host clock; use the injected clock interface instead. Include the failing run's build token in any support request; it appears at the bottom of the job summary, here.

build token for fajof-yahof: htk4_869f